Pasta and Surprise Meatballs


Pasta sauce:


2 Tbsp olive oil

2 cloves fresh minced garlic

1/2 cup minced onion

2-6 oz. cans tomato paste

1-28 oz. can crushed tomatoes

2 cups water

1/3 cup sugar

1 bay leaf

1 Tbsp basil

1/2 tsp thyme

1/2 tsp majoram

1 Tbsp parsley

1 tsp salt

1 tsp pepper


Over medium heat, put olive oil, onion and garlic into a large saucepan and sautee for 2-3 minutes. Stir in water, followed by the remaining ingredients. Heat to a simmer, reduce heat to low and cover.

Meatballs:


1 pound ground beef

2 eggs

1/2 cup bread crumbs

1/3 cup parmesan cheese

1/3 cup finely chopped mushrooms

2 Tbsp minced onion

2 tsp oregano

1/2 tsp basil

1/2 tsp salt

1/2 tsp pepper

......and the surprise?

4 slices provolone cheese


Beat 2 eggs into medium mixing bowl. Add all other ingredients except provolone cheese. Blend ingredients thoroughly.


Heat 1 Tbsp olive oil in another skillet on medium/low. Form meat balls of desired size, adding a bit of provolone cheese to the center of each, and drop into skillet. Turn carefully and frequently with love until lightly brown on all sides. Put meatballs into sauce and continue to simmer for up to an hour. (I did more like a half hour, it smelled too good to wait!)


Serve over favorite pasta.
